Original Description
Kate Greenaway’s Christmas Caroling is a charming Victorian-era illustration that radiates warmth and nostalgia. The painting depicts children dressed in quaint period costumes, their rosy cheeks glowing as they sing carols in a snow-dusted village setting. Greenaway’s delicate, lyrical style—characterized by soft lines, pastel hues, and idyllic scenes—evokes an innocence and whimsy emblematic of the late 19th-century children’s book illustration movement. A pioneer in her field, Greenaway blended elements of the Aesthetic Movement and Romanticism, creating timeless images that celebrated childhood and rural simplicity. Her work, including Christmas Caroling, became iconic in commercial art and book illustration, influencing holiday imagery for generations. Today, this piece remains a beloved example of Victorian sentimentalism, cherished for its ability to transport viewers to a gentler, more festive past.
